%T Compiling CSP
%A Frederick R. M. Barnes
%E Peter H. Welch, Jon Kerridge, Frederick R. M. Barnes
%B Communicating Process Architectures 2006
%X CSP, Hoare\[rs]s Communicating Sequential Processes, is a
   formal language for specifying, implementing and reasoning
   about concurrent processes and their interactions. Existing
   software tools that deal with CSP directly are largely
   concerned with assisting formal proofs. This paper presents
   an alternative use for CSP, namely the compilation of CSP
   systems to executable code. Themain motivation for this work
   is in providing a means to experimentwith relatively large
   CSP systems, possibly consisting millions of concurrent
   processes \- something that is hard to achieve with the
   tools currently available.
